Output efce4516589e2de26d1013972d617139cb857837580226e9373c9819bc8d3897:0

value
14257464
script pubkey
OP_0 OP_PUSHBYTES_20 3cee5b8f73d76af53be00b46124a485d59f82299
address
bc1q8nh9hrmn6a402wlqpdrpyjjgt4vlsg5echu5zr
transaction
efce4516589e2de26d1013972d617139cb857837580226e9373c9819bc8d3897
confirmations
188910
spent
true